John Kertis Obituary

John Ross Kertis was born on June 26, 1961, in Kirkland, Washington to Howard and Barbara Kertis. He passed away on October 25, 2024, at the age of sixty-three. He grew up on the Olympic Peninsula and attended Sequim schools. John was a dedicated and skilled professional in the construction trades, where he spent many years contributing to the development and improvement of his community. His work was marked by a commitment to quality and a strong work ethic. John finished his career working as the manager of Jamestown Excavating from 1996 to 2018 when he retired from employment.

John had a passion for the outdoors, finding joy in bird hunting east of the mountains, target shooting at Sunnydell Gun Club, and river fishing on the Dungeness and many rivers out west. These activities were not just hobbies but a way for him to connect with nature and find peace and relaxation.

John is survived by his sisters, Annette (Peter) Nesse and Lisa (Chuck) Parrish, who thoroughly enjoyed their brother's warmth and humor. He also leaves behind his niece, Callie (Steven) Higgs, and nephew, Cory (Chloe) Parrish, who will fondly remember their uncle's kindness and the special moments they shared. He was also the proud great uncle to Zealand and Angus Higgs. He was preceded in death by his parents.

John was married twice, first to Waynora Martin and later to Cindy Fittro. Though these marriages ended, they were significant chapters in his life, filled with shared experiences and personal growth.

John's life was one of hard work, love for the outdoors, and cherished family connections. He will be remembered for his dedication to his craft, his love of nature, and the deep bonds he shared with his family. His passing leaves a void in the hearts of those who knew him, but his memory will live on through the stories and experiences shared by those he touched.

A private celebration of life is planned for spring of 2025.
